Service Ticket Repair Information: CUSTOMER STATES THE VEHICLE WAS GOING INTO LIMP MODE AND NOT SHIFTING UNTIL HE SHUT IT OFF AND TURNED IT BACK ON. HE CHECKED CODES AND HAD TRANSMISSION MODULE FAULTS STORED. VEHICLE HAS BEEN PARKED FOR A COUPLE MONTHS DUE TO THIS, BUT NOW IT NEEDS JUMP STARTING TO RUN, BUT DOESN'T COME OUT OF PARK. CHECK AND ADVISE. After charging the battery, the key will turn, but won't crank or come out of park. We scanned for codes and found numerous CAN faults throughout the vehicle, and no communication with the transmission or shifter module. The engine showed these codes: P2030-004 No or incorrect CAN message from electronic selector lever module control unit, and P2037-004 No or incorrect CAN message from ETC control unit. We inspected the CAN connectors in both kick panels and no corrosion was found. We inspected the transmission control module and no corrosion or fluid intrusion was found. We inspected the front SAM and found 2 blown fuses, one for the cig lighter, and the other for the trans and shifter modules. We replaced both fuses and the car starts and comes out of gear now, but there is a hard bang when going into drive or reverse, then the car doesn't want to back to park. The key has to be turned off to get it into park. We scanned for codes and can communicate with all modules now. The selector module has P1856 Selector lever position detection has failed, and the transmission module has P240C The selector lever position sent from electronic selector lever module control unit via the can bus is implausible. We cleared the codes and initially drove the vehicle with no problems. After letting it sit overnight, it banged into gear again and triggered the same faults. We tried to access the selector module, but something has been spilled on the center console and essentially glued the panel in place. We believe the same substance caused the selector module to fail, and would recommend replacing it, with the knowledge that parts of the center console may break when trying to access it.
